“Microsoft accused European Union regulators Thursday of
arranging ‘secret contacts’ between its competitors and cast doubt
on the independence of an EU-appointed monitor.“The software maker, facing the threat of $2.4 million in daily
fines for not complying with an EU antitrust ruling, said in a
14-page filing that the European Commission ‘actively encouraged
Microsoft’s adversaries to ‘educate’ the trustee in a manner
detrimental to Microsoft…'”
